I modded another Thorfire TG06. This one will be a gift to someone who will appreciate nimh compatibility so I kept the stock driver. I swapped the XPG2 for a 5000k 219C. Kept the forward clicky since it works well with the odd stock driver configuration (HLM no memory). Added a bleed resistor to the stock driver. Then another PD68 Rev 5.1 lighted tailcap, this time in green.

I measured lighted tailcap draw on this one since it’s a gift and I wanted to give some idea on drain when not used frequently. This one pulls 0.24 mA from a fresh cell. Configuration is a 19.1k resistor for all 3 channels and green LEDs. Brighter than it needs to be, but my 36k resistors are still in the mail. Going off of info from the X5 group buy thread I expect well over a month from a fresh 650ma efest.

Modded a Jetbeam DDC20.

This is an old 500 lumen XML light that I picked up on clearance. I swapped out the emitter and star for a 4000K XPL HI 5A2 tint. I also swapped the battery tube for an 18350-sized tube from a Jetbeam DDC10.

It’s not the brightest light around and the UI isn’t fantastic. It’s also quite large. Running on a single 18350, the light is bigger than my Zebralight SC63w and DQG Tiny III and IV.

It has one unique and sorta gimmicky (but cool) feature: A 7-segment digital red LED display that shows the mode and battery level. The battery meter seems to work pretty well.

This isn’t as good as the display in the Imalent lights, but on the other hand, the Jetbeam is smaller than the Imalents and the button is easier to use.

The black X2R receives the typical XP-L HI & FET+1 treatment.

15mm FET+1 with bistro FW from RMM: in the charging PCB the first two pin are removed, the second one replaced by 22awg teflon wire and connects to the positive side of the driver, third pin is shortened and soldered to the ( - ) ring. Two extra solder points secures the microUSB connector housing (connected to ground) with the new driver. It is very firmly secured and won’t require potting.

The XP-L HI V1 1A on 16mm noctigon sits perfectly on the shelf. The centering ring is made by Hoop, XP to 7mm size. The new convoy 7mm centering also works but this one is black and looks better.

Now it is much brighter and has better UI. The beam although being tighter is still the floody type, as it seems very difficult to achieve any throw with this small OP reflector, even smaller than the S2+ reflector.

The integrated charging system remains untouched but with a caveat: the light has to be ON for charging. There is nearly no impact on the charge rate if I leave it in moonlight:

On the other hand, it now works as an usb powered light. Drawing up to 1A it provides decent lighting in an emergency situation.

Put a XP-L V6 1A into an EE X6. With dome on, I measured 1690 lumens (semi-calibrated ceiling bounce test) and 49.4 Kcd. Dedomed, I measured 1547 lumens and 93.7 Kcd. Significantly brighter than the XPL HI V2 3B at 70 Kcd. All with fresh 30Q at 20-30sec.

I had trouble dedoming this particular XPL V6 1A. I have dedomed 6 others and the dome came off easily after 30-60 minutes of soaking in warm gas. With this one an “outer dome” came off easily but there was a large piece of silicone stuck to the die that would not separate easily. I ended up taking it out of the gas and carefully scraping the silicone off with a blade. Has anyone experienced this behavior with dedoming XPLs?
